My New Athletic Love

During the time I was experiencing exertional compartment syndrome symptoms when skating, I fell in love with another sport, downhill snow skiing. It was because of my enjoyment of snow skiing, I was able to give up skating. I was overjoyed that skiing did not seem to have the same painful effect on my legs. On rare occasions I would have an attack if I was on a level slope (cat walk) and had to propel myself using movements similar to cross country skiing and inline skating. But these were manageable.

I told myself that if the exertional compartment syndrome began to truly interfere with my enjoyment of snow skiing, I would reconsider having the surgery.

I continued to ski with only occasional problems, especially after having had my ski boots custom fitted and surgery was the furthest thing from my mind. For several years, I was able to enjoy mostly pain free skiing.
